What are the job opportunities in Dubai after completing masters in pharmacy?

Yes, there are strong job opportunities in Dubai after a Master's in Pharmacy.

You can find roles in hospitals, pharmaceutical companies, research labs, healthcare clinics, and regulatory agencies. Common positions include clinical pharmacist, pharmaceutical sales and marketing, drug safety officer, regulatory affairs specialist, research scientist, and hospital pharmacy manager.

To work in Dubai, you must obtain a Dubai Health Authority (DHA) license, which requires passing the DHA exam. Most employers will sponsor your employment visa once you secure a job offer.
